Arnan PanaliganArnan C. Panaligan is the current Governor of the province of Oriental Mindoro as well as the current Vice President of Luzon of the League of Provinces of the Philippines. He is also a former Vice Governor of the same province and former Mayor of Calapan.

Arnan Panaligan is the first gubernatorial candidate of Oriental Mindoro to ever win in all the towns of the province. He entered politics in 1995 as a municipal mayor of Calapan, Oriental Mindoro, where he served for three terms. It was during his term as mayor that Calapan is converted into a city. Then he was elected Vice governor in 2004 but assumed office as Governor upon the death of the late governor Bartolome Marasigan.

Hailed as the architect of the progress of Calapan City, Panaligan was responsible for transforming the former sleepy town of Calapan into a booming and progressive city. His administration built concrete roads and drainage network, opened schools in the rural areas, provided health insurance to poor families and scholarships to thousands of young people. Indeed, Governor Panaligan has implemented poverty alleviating programs that impact directly on the quality of life of the people. His tenure also marked the entry of investments that contributed to the progress of the whole province. Oriental Mindoro now plays a vital role in nation-building as Governor Panaligan pursues development efforts to maximize the province’s potentials as a major agricultural producer and as the emerging eco-tourism destination of the country.

A lawyer by profession, Panaligan finished law at the Ateneo Law School in 1987 and passed the Bar that same year. His previous experiences in the government include a stint in the Supreme Court as a legal researcher after passing the Bar and in the House of Representatives Electoral Tribunal as a technical assistant.

He was born on January 21, 1962 in Calapan City, Oriental Mindoro.
